"Gabriel F. T. Gomes" <gftg@linux.vnet.ibm.com> writes:
> During the development of float128 on powerpc64le, the ulps have been
> generated since early versions of the patches. On those versions, the
> functions gamma and pow10 were mistakenly thought to be part of the API.
> After review, the functions were removed, however the ulps for them were
> carried in the ulps file.
>
> This patch removes such entries from the ulps file, as well as it
> shrinks the ulps for the cpow and lgamma functions.
LGTM.
